Filing this issue to track/ discuss generic function support for gotests.
Currently, gotests produces a table driven test for a function with type parameters, but the test needs to actually be modified to include concrete types (the test file will have build errors).
Example:
typeparams.go:
typeparams_test.go:
Can better table driven tests be generated for functions with type params / should the generated tests make sure there are no build errors?
